My Family, Mental Illness, and Me

My Family, Mental Illness, and Me - More than three million young people in the UK either live or care for a loved one experiencing a mental illness. This podcast, brought to you by the charity Our Time and presented by Dr Pamela Jenkins, features conversations with a loved one about what this might be like.

It explores this complicated topic with sensitivity, providing a sense of companionship and solidarity for any listeners who can relate to these stories. Episodes so far include an interview with the celebrated ornithologist Mya-Rose Craig, talking about her mum and her experiences with bipolar disorder. There’s also a chat with Emma Kennedy, who wrote about her mother in her book ‘Letters from Brenda: My Mother’s Lifetime of Secrets.’
